ICF/MR
ICF-MR (Intermediate Care Facilities for Persons with Mental Retardation) homes are designed to assist individuals with comprehensive needs to live active, fulfilling, and productive lives.
They offer intensive, 24-hour staffing to meet the comprehensive needs of the residents. An interdisciplinary team comprised of the resident, his/her family members, RSI staff members, and consultants determine the nature of services required by each resident based on his/her needs, goals, and desires. Services available include psychological supports; social work; speech/language therapy; occupational therapy; physical therapy; recreation; and dietary, nursing, and pharmacy consultation.
Our Life Options program provides vocational and learning services during the day for adults living in ICF-MR homes. Children living in ICF-MR homes attend public schools.
